    Santa and his elves will be at Blackberry Farm each weekend, collecting children’s wish lists at the Carriage Museum. There’s a sleigh full of other activities, including:

      • Gift Shop: Find antique vintage toys and stocking stuffers.
      • A Huntoon Christmas: Visit holiday displays and color a Holiday Express coloring book!
      • North Pole Oasis (Carriage Museum): Visit Santa Claus and pose for a picture! Be sure to let Santa know what presents you would like!
      • Candy Cane Village (Adventure Playground): Enjoy Blackberry’s beautifully lit playground (weather permitting).
      • North Pole Depot: All Aboard the Holiday Express Train!
      • Winter Sleigh Ride: Dash through the snow on a cozy wagon ride.
      • Little Elf Hobby Shoppe (Weaver’s Cabin): Create a candy cane ornament to hang on your tree.
      • Sugar Plum Playland: Explore the winter-themed sensory table. This attraction closes at dusk.
      • Gingerbread School House: Listen to classic holiday stories while keeping warm by our real wood burning stove.
      • Kringle’s Café: Stop by Santa’s favorite café for some delicious hot cocoa and treats.
      • Holiday Village (Early Streets Museum)Warm up with an indoor craft and great Christmas music. Stop by our Reindeer Food Bar and create a feed bag to put out on Christmas Eve.
    Holiday Express FAQs and Refund Policy

    Are Holiday Express tickets refundable?
    All ticket sales are final, refunds and ticket transfers are not available after purchase. Blackberry Farm is open rain, snow or shine and ticket holders are encouraged to dress for the weather. If Blackberry Farm cancels an event ticket holder will be issued a full refund. Ticket holders must provide proof of purchase to receive a refund.

    We have a schedule conflict can we use our tickets on a different day?
    Tickets are only valid for their date of purchase and cannot be transferred to any other day.

    Tickets are sold out; how can I get tickets to the event?
    Unfortunately, once an event is sold out we cannot add more tickets. We want to ensure our guests have a great experience at every event and staying within the set ticket limit for the event is an important aspect to that.

    Can I show my tickets on my phone or do they need to be printed?
    Tickets can be shown on a phone or printed. When showing your tickets on a phone please show the actual PDF, a screen shot cannot be scanned.

    Who do I need to purchase a ticket for?
    Everyone ages 1 and up must have a ticket for Holiday Express.

    Can I leave tickets at admissions for other people in our group?
    Will call is not available. If other guests in your party are meeting you after your arrival, please meet them at admissions with their tickets.

    How should we dress for Holiday Express?
    Guests will spend a lot of time outdoors at Holiday Express and we recommend dressing for the weather. If there is snow in the forecast, we recommend snow pants and boots.

    When does the train leave?
    The Holiday Express train ride runs continuously throughout the event and ticket holders do not have to reserve a time to get on the train. The train ride is approximately 8 minutes long.

    How many times can we ride the train?
    Ticket holders may ride the train as often as they like but must exit the train and get back in line to ride again.

    I have tickets for Hot Cocoa w/ Anna & Elsa or Storytime with the Grinch, can I attend Holiday Express as well?
    Yes, Holiday Express is included with the event ticket. You may arrive early or stay late depending on the time of your event. Please reference the hours of operation below to determine the best time to arrive.

    What time can we come to Holiday Express?
    You can arrive at any time during operating hours on the date your ticket is purchased for and will want to plan to spend about 1.5 – 2 hours at Blackberry farm. The best time to arrive to see the Holiday lights in full display is after 4 p.m.

    Hours of Operation:
    Thursday & Friday: 5 to 8 p.m.
    Saturday & Sunday: 2 to 7 p.m.

    Is food available for purchase? Can we bring in our own food and drink?
    Yes, the concession is available offering a variety of snacks and drinks including hot chocolate. Guests may also bring in their own food and drink, alcohol is not permitted.
